Makes 8 cinnamon rolls.
Cinnamon Roll Ingredients
1 ¾ cup flour, plus more for dusting
1 tbsp baking powder
1 ¼ tsp salt
3 tbsp butter, melted
1 tbsp cinnamon
⅓ cup sugar
Icing Ingredients
¼ cup powdered sugar
Steps
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der and salt until well combined. Mix in the yogurt until combined, then use your hands to knead until the dough balls up. This may take a few minutes so be patient.
Lightly dust a work surface with flour and roll out the dough into a rectangular shape about ½ thick. Brush on the melted butter, then sprinkle on the cinnamon and sugar, evenly distributing them throughout the dough.
Gently roll up the dough from one of the narrow ends to the other until you have a cylinder. Using a very sharp knife cut cylinder into 6-8 pieces. Arrange the pieces on the lined baking sheet and bake for about 25-30 minutes, until the edges are just golden brown.
While the cinnamon rolls are baking, make the icing by whisking together the powdered sugar and vanilla bean yogurt.
Remove cinnamon rolls from the oven and pour the icing over. Enjoy warm.
